So yea...my new rims/tires are off a jeep with a 5x5 pattern not our 5x5.5. I'd have to buy 4 wheel adapters which is gonna be another $200(ish) unless you guys know where to get em cheap or have something in mind I'm not aware of. Help! (or I'll cancel the check and give em back)

get rid of the rims. by putting wheel adapters on you are putting more strain on the frt suspension. you think the tire rod ends and ball joints suck now, give it a couple months with the new set up. the wear and tear is incredible.
